Microsoft libera el código de Microsoft BASIC, creado por Bill Gates en 1978
Recientemente, Microsoft ha tomado la decisión de liberar el código fuente de Microsoft BASIC, un lenguaje de programación que fue creado en 1978 por Bill Gates y Paul Allen. Este acontecimiento marca un hito significativo en la historia de la programación y el software, dado que BASIC fue uno de los primeros lenguajes que permitió a los usuarios interactuar con las computadoras personales.
Contexto histórico
Microsoft BASIC fue diseñado inicialmente para el Altair 8800, una de las primeras computadoras personales. Este lenguaje no solo facilitó la programación a los usuarios menos técnicos, sino que también sentó las bases para futuros desarrollos en lenguajes de programación más avanzados. La liberación del código fuente permite a los entusiastas y desarrolladores estudiar su funcionamiento interno y entender mejor la evolución del software desde sus inicios.
Detalles técnicos del código liberado
El código liberado incluye versiones originales que fueron ejecutadas en sistemas como el Altair 8800 y otros microordenadores contemporáneos. Esto proporciona una oportunidad única para analizar cómo se implementaban funciones básicas como la entrada/salida y el manejo de variables en una época donde los recursos computacionales eran extremadamente limitados.
- Lenguaje: BASIC (Beginner’s All-purpose Symbolic Instruction Code)
- Año de creación: 1978
- Creador: Bill Gates y Paul Allen
- Sistemas soportados: Altair 8800 y otros microordenadores
Implicaciones para la comunidad tecnológica
La liberación del código tiene varias implicaciones significativas:
- Preservación histórica: Permite conservar un fragmento importante de la historia del desarrollo del software.
- Educación: Los estudiantes y nuevos programadores pueden aprender sobre las bases de la programación a través del estudio directo del código original.
- Cultura open source: Fomenta una mayor colaboración dentro de la comunidad tecnológica, alineándose con las tendencias actuales hacia el software abierto.
Aprovechamiento del código liberado
Dada su naturaleza educativa, este código puede ser utilizado por universidades e instituciones educativas para crear cursos sobre historia de la programación o sobre técnicas fundamentales que aún son relevantes hoy en día. Además, desarrolladores experimentales pueden utilizar este recurso para crear proyectos basados en tecnologías antiguas o incluso adaptar conceptos antiguos a entornos modernos.
Cierre del legado tecnológico
A medida que se avanza hacia un futuro cada vez más digitalizado, iniciativas como esta ayudan a mantener viva la historia detrás del desarrollo tecnológico. La apertura del código fuente no solo es un homenaje al pasado, sino también una invitación a futuros innovadores a construir sobre los cimientos establecidos por pioneros como Bill Gates y Paul Allen.
Para más información visita la Fuente original.